A Fool, Free

by Beate Grimsrud

A Fool, Free is the extraordinary story (allegedly fiction, but suspiciously similar to the author’s own life) of schizophrenic Swedish/Norwegian Eli, a successful filmmaker and author. Eli battles the many personas inhabiting her mind, medication (too much or too little) and nurses and doctors with a varying degree of understanding of how best to treat her. An enlightening look at a mental illness shrouded in myths and fear.
